Kajeet Launches Malfunctioning Pets Mystery to Get Text-Happy Kids on the Hook

malfunctioning_pets.png

For its client Kajeet, Philly-based Red Tettemer launched an 8-part webisode campaign called The Mysterious Mystery of the Malfunctioning Pets. One episode will be unveiled every week on Dudeworld.

Kajeet provides pay-as-you-go cell phone service for kids. Participating tweens will be able to help decide the ending.

A few seconds into the first episode we heard this high-pitched scream, the likes of which we haven’t experienced since Sailor Moon.

After you cross the threshold of age 13, you just can’t process that kind of sound anymore. Some small part of us died.

Anyway, the episode was cute. If our pets malfunctioned, we’d probably just sell them.
